The Last Time I Saw Mama

The last time I saw mama, she could hardly get around. Her body was weak and feeble. Her strength had let her down. Her hands were old and callused and her hair was almost white. But, the next time I see mama; it'll be a different sight.

Chorus: On her head, she'll wear a golden crown. On her face, there'll never be a frown. And, her smile will wear the seal of God. Oh yes! She'll be walking on the ground where angels trod.

The last time I saw mama, age had hit her hard. Her body was old and feeble; time had left its scars. Her nights were long and restless, and often filled with pain. But, the next time I see mama; it'll be a different thing.

Chorus
